The Story Behind Princess Diana's Ring

After the engagement, the ring garnered considerable media attention, rapidly cementing its status as a cultural icon. After her heartbreaking loss in 1997, the ring was inherited by her son, Prince William, who subsequently offered it to Catherine, Duchess of Cambridge, deepening its connection to modern royal history. At present, the ring continues to stand as a poignant reminder of Diana's profound effect on the monarchy and popular culture, celebrated for its elegance and the emotional connections it embodies.

Exceptional Color and Clarity

Though numerous gemstones fascinate with their appeal, blue sapphires are recognized by their unparalleled color and clarity. The profound, lustrous tone of a blue sapphire inspires a sense of calm and refinement, often linked to prestige and sophistication. This striking color is caused by the existence of iron and titanium throughout its mineral formation. Additionally, the transparency of blue sapphires elevates their aesthetic; superior gems show limited imperfections, enabling light to radiate through them magnificently. This fusion of striking color and superior brilliance makes blue sapphires remarkably coveted. Effect on Engagement Rings

Diana's iconic sapphire engagement ring not only enchanted admirers but also reshaped the entire engagement ring industry. Its remarkable design, showcasing a magnificent blue sapphire encircled by diamonds, moved attention away from classic diamond solitaires toward colored gemstones. This daring decision inspired couples to celebrate their individuality, resulting in a dramatic increase in demand for distinctive and customized rings. Jewelers responded by incorporating diverse stones and innovative designs, allowing for greater customization. Diana's celebrated ring transformed into a hallmark of modern love, encouraging countless individuals to pursue alternatives beyond conventional ring designs. The impact reached further than visual appeal, as the ring's history and association with Diana gave it deep emotional meaning, strengthening the notion that engagement rings could embody personal stories rather than simply signifying wealth.

Who Created Princess Diana's Legendary Engagement Ring?

The iconic bridal ring worn by Princess Diana was made by jeweler Garrard. It features a striking sapphire adorned with diamonds, reflecting sophistication and individuality, and has long since become an enduring symbol of royal love.

What Was Princess Diana's Ring Originally Worth?

Princess Diana's iconic engagement ring originally cost approximately £28,000 back in 1981, which was roughly $37,000 at the time. Its unique design and stunning sapphire have contributed to its lasting legacy and iconic status.

What Materials Are Used in the Ring's Design?

The ring features an extraordinary 12-carat oval sapphire, complemented by fourteen diamonds. Crafted in 18k white gold, its elegant design showcases a harmonious mix of bold colors and finishes, underscoring its enduring beauty and value.

Where Can Princess Diana's Ring Be Found Today?

Princess Diana's legendary ring is presently held by her son, the Prince of Wales, who bestowed it upon Catherine, the Princess of Wales. It stands as a beloved symbol of love and legacy within the royal family.
